diff --git a/auth.go b/auth.go index 5983c85..f81d864 100644 --- a/auth.go +++ b/auth.go @@ -36,7 +36,7 @@ func verifyTokenInSession(c echo.Context) (bool, *mastodon.Account, error) { } type LoginRequest struct { - ServerHost string `validate:"required,hostname,fqdn" form:"server"` + ServerHost string `validate:"required,fqdn" form:"server"` Redirect string `validate:"url_encoded" form:"redir"` } diff --git a/config.go b/config.go index 9959997..5868a8d 100644 --- a/config.go +++ b/config.go @@ -21,7 +21,7 @@ type ( } AppConfigBase struct { - LocalDomain string `validate:"required,hostname|hostname_port"` + LocalDomain string `validate:"required,fqdn"` Environment string `validate:"printascii"` StorageDir string LogoImageBlueBack image.Image